Finland vs. Greece

20 Jul 2026 · incl. all taxes

Petrol (Euro 95)

Greece is 9.4% cheaper (petrol)

Diesel

Greece is 12.6% cheaper (diesel)

Petrol in Finland costs 216.29 ct/L compared to 197.70 ct/L in Greece. For diesel, the prices are 219.59 ct/L and 195.00 ct/L respectively.

Filling a 50-litre tank with petrol costs approximately €108.15 in Finland versus €98.85 in Greece — a difference of €9.30.
